📍Introduction

Locally known as "KK," Kota Kinabalu City Centre is a lively and diverse area. Visitors can explore a mix of modern shopping malls, traditional markets, and cultural landmarks. The city centre is well-connected, offering easy access to nearby islands, making it a convenient base for exploring Sabah’s natural beauty. Expect to experience a dynamic urban environment with beautiful coastal views, local delicacies, and a variety of entertainment options.


🌟 Attraction Points in Kota Kinabalu and Surrounding Areas

Gaya Street

  • - Highlight: Famous for its Sunday market, offering local crafts, food, and souvenirs.
  • - Travel: Located in the city center, easily accessible by foot or short drive.


➰Signal Hill Observatory

  • - Highlight: Offers panoramic views of Kota Kinabalu city and the South China Sea.
  • - Travel: ~10 minutes by car from the city center.


➰ Atkinson Clock Tower

  • Highlight: One of Kota Kinabalu’s oldest historical landmarks.
  • Travel: Located near Gaya Street, within walking distance of the city center.


➰Sabah State Mosque

  • Highlight A beautiful mosque featuring a majestic golden dome and intricate architecture.
  • Travel: ~10 minutes by car from the city center.


Filipino Market (Pasar Filipina)

  • Highlight A vibrant market known for its variety of local handicrafts, souvenirs, and fresh seafood. It's a must-visit for those looking to experience local culture and cuisine.
  • Travel: Located in the city center, just a short walk from many hotels and other attractions. Easily accessible by car, foot, or taxi.


Mari-Mari Cultural Village

  • Highlight: Experience traditional Sabah ethnic cultures, including local crafts, performances, and food.
  • Travel: ~30 minutes by car from Kota Kinabalu city.


Kokol Hill

  • Highlight: Offers cool mountain air and stunning views of Kota Kinabalu, perfect for a relaxing retreat.
  • Travel: ~45 minutes by car from the city center.


➰Tanjung Aru Beach

  • Highlight: Famous for its breathtaking sunsets, ideal for evening strolls and beach activities.
  • Travel: ~15 minutes by car from Kota Kinabalu city.


Rumah Terbalik (Upside Down House)

  • Highlight A unique attraction where everything is upside down, offering a fun photo opportunity.
  • Travel: ~30 minutes by car from Kota Kinabalu city.


Koisan Cultural Village

  • Highlight A cultural site that showcases the traditions and lifestyles of the Kadazan-Dusun people.
  • Travel: ~40 minutes by car from Kota Kinabalu city.


✨ Firefly Spotting near Kota Kinabalu City Centre

Klias River

  • Distance: ~2 hours by car
  • Highlight: Famous for firefly tours along the mangrove-lined river.


Weston Wetland

  • Distance: ~1.5 hours by car
  • Highlight Another popular spot for firefly-watching in a serene wetland environment.


Dream Beach, Bongawan

  • Distance: ~1.5 hours by car
  • Highlight A scenic beach area with opportunities for firefly tours along the nearby river.


Kawa-Kawa

  • Distance: ~1 hour by car
  • Highlight: Known for its rich mangrove forests and firefly-watching experiences.


➰Mengkabong River

  • Distance: ~45 minutes by car
  • Highlight A picturesque spot close to the city, ideal for a quick firefly-watching trip.


Binsuluk

  • Distance: ~1.5 hours by car
  • Highlight: Offers a quiet and lesser-known location for firefly-watching, away from the crowds.


Tuaran Peri

  • Distance: ~1 hour by car
  • Highlight: A peaceful location for observing fireflies, with easy access from Kota Kinabalu.



🛍️Shopping Malls & Restaurants

➰ Shopping Malls:

  • Suria Sabah: Modern mall with international and local brands.
  • Imago Shopping Mall: Upscale shopping and dining experience.
  • Centre Point Sabah: A mix of retail stores and local eateries.
  • Oceanus Waterfront Mall: Shopping with a view of the sea.


➰Restaurants:

  • Welcome Seafood Restaurant: Known for fresh seafood.
  • Yee Fung Laksa: Must-try for laksa lovers.
  • Little Italy: Popular for Italian dishes.
  • Nook Café: Cozy spot for coffee and brunch.



🥂 Night Life & Markets

➰Night Markets:

  • Filipino Market (Pasar Filipina): Open from 5.30pm to 11pm, offering street food, souvenirs, and handicrafts.
  • Segama Night Market: Smaller market with local snacks and produce.


➰Nightlife Spots:

  • Shenanigan's Fun Pub: Popular for live music and drinks.
  • Sky Blu Bar: Rooftop bar with stunning views at Le Meridien Hotel.
  • El Centro: Cozy bar with a mix of cocktails and comfort food.
  • Breeze Beach Club: Beachfront bar perfect for sunsets at Pacific Sutera Hotel.

How to Get There
🚩How to Get Around Kota Kinabalu City 🚶🏻Walking ➰Best For Exploring the city center, Gaya Street, Jesselton Point, and nearby attractions. ❗️Tip: The city center is compact, and many attractions are within walking distance of each other. 🚕 Taxis/Grab ➰Best for Convenient and fast travel around the city, especially to areas further from the center like Signal Hill Observatory, Tanjung Aru Beach, and Sabah State Mosque. ❗️Tip: Grab is widely used in Kota Kinabalu, and fares are typically affordable. 🚌 Public Buses ➰Best For Budget-friendly travel to various parts of the city and nearby towns. ❗️Tip: Buses may not be as frequent or punctual, so it's best for less time-sensitive travel. 🚗 Car Rentals ➰Best For Exploring attractions outside the city center like Mari-Mari Cultural Village, Kokol Hill, and Firefly locations. ❗️Tip: Renting a car allows you to travel at your own pace, but be prepared for local traffic and parking conditions. 🚲 Bicycle Rentals ➰Best For Exploring the waterfront and parks around the city. ❗️ Tip: Some hotels and hostels offer bicycle rentals, and it's a great way to enjoy the scenic areas at a leisurely pace. 🚙 Tourist Vans/Shuttle Services ➰Best For Group travel or scheduled trips to popular attractions like the islands, Mari-Mari Cultural Village, or Kinabalu Park- ❗️Tip: Many tours include transportation, so this is a hassle-free option for tourists. 🛵 Motorbike Rentals ➰Best For Solo travelers or couples looking for a flexible and adventurous way to explore Kota Kinabalu and nearby areas. ❗️Tip: Motorbikes are great for navigating through city traffic and reaching attractions that are slightly off the beaten path, like Kokol Hill or the outskirts of the city."
